Jack Wilshere's Arsenal U18s have game postponed after team bus travels to Bournemouth instead of Brighton

It's a strange reason.

Chris Byfield

Chris Byfield

google discoverFollow us on Google Discover

Arsenal’s U18s game against Brighton & Hove Albion has been called off for a peculiar reason.

At midday on Saturday, when the game was initially scheduled to kick off, Arsenal announced that their Under 18’s encounter against the Seagulls had been postponed.

However, the club failed to provide an explanation on the matter.

It has since been widely reported that the game had been postponed because the team coach ended up in Bournemouth instead of Brighton.

Advert

The fixture was supposed to kick off at midday at Brighton’s AMEX Football Centre. but was then delayed until 12.30pm before being postponed. The game will now have to take place at a later date.

The Arsenal squad ended up in Bournemouth, some 95 miles distance from Brighton, and a two-hour and 21 minute drive away.

As per Jeorge Bird, who runs ‘Arsenal Youth’, Jack Wilshere’s young Gunners side had named Alexei Rojas in the starting lineup in place of Noah Cooper, while Will Sweet, Zach Shuaib and Omari Benjamin were all set to start.

Moreover, the under-18s side, who had been looking to extend their unbeaten run in all competitions to four matches, named Maldini Kacurri, Louie Copley and Seb Ferdinand in the squad, having also been part of the U21 side last night.

Trialist Mason Cotcher was also set to start up front.

Arsenal team: Rojas; Ferdinand, Kacurri, W. Sweet, Brown; Shuaib, Akolbire, Copley; Oyetunde, Cotcher, Benjamin.

Subs: Cooper, C. Ismail, Ryan, Obi-Martin.
